I have an old Prostar DCS. I was wandering if anyone could tell me how to program ringing on this system. I have it installed and have managed to get everything working. I just want to make all lines appear and ring on all phones.

I assume you understand the programming?
Ringing is assigned in MMC 406.You can assign either a direct extension or a group.You must use a group if you want more than 1 phone to ring.If you do this then you must assign the group in MMC 601.Just make sure if you do this to set the ring type to unconditional and include all the extensions that you want to ring as members of the group.
For key programming use MMC 722.This is on a per station basis.
If all the phones are the same then you could use MMC723 for system key programming.
Or you can program 1 phone and use MMC720 to copy the key programming from 1 phone to another.
Direct trunk keys are DT7XX.Example a key code for a line 1 button would be DT701.
